What is an e-Bill?

The "e-Bill" is a new option for Columbia Gas of Ohio customers to receive their gas bill. Developed in partnership with Checkfree Corporation, the e-Bill is an electronic version of the paper bill that you receive today, but is accessible over the internet by using an internet browser. The e-Bill resides on Checkfree's website, and contains links to our home page containing additional information such as "Gaslines" (our monthly customer publication), other bill inserts, customer service information, and safety and conservation messages. All information, including bill messages specific to you, will continue to appear on the e-Bill just as it will on the paper bill.

What if I forget to look at my bill?

Checkfree will send you an e-mail reminder if you have not looked at a new e-Bill four days after it is rendered at their site.

Will the service be available to all customers?

This service is available to the majority of our commercial CHOICE® customers. Internet access through a browser, which supports Secured Sockets Connections and an e-mail address, are additional requirements. Although customers may be able to access their bills through public terminals at libraries, schools, or senior centers, they will need their own e-mail address so that Checkfree can notify them after four days if their bill has gone unopened.

Placing information about myself or my financial accounts on the Internet makes me nervous. How will my transactions be kept confidential and safe from others?

Transactions to and from Checkfree's web page will be encrypted. Essentially this means that any information sent between your browser and Checkfree is scrambled using state-of-the-art equipment while it is being communicated. This is a standard protective measure being used by the majority of businesses today that are performing financial transactions on the Internet.
